Bethel Healing Center pastor Irene Manjeri has asked whoever claims she has ever been dark-skinned to provide picture evidence. In past interviews, she has categorically stated that she doesn't bleach her skin.

“I don’t know why my appearance perturbs people. If a woman looks good, it brings glory unto the name of the Lord. I am a public figure; a pastor.  So should I not look good just to please people? No. I have the right to look good,” she emphasised in a television interview recently.

Manjeri vowed to maintain her look, saying she will not change it for anyone.

“I am used to looking good and for those who don’t understand it, I am so sorry. I won’t change for anyone. I have been anointed looking this and I will continue to be anointed looking like this,” she explained.

The 51-year-old, however, warned whoever is up for the challenge against using Adobe Photoshop skills to darken her complexion.

She asserted that she has always been light-skinned. However, the pastor’s skin complexion has always been a contentious issue.
